Maccabi Haifa midfielder, Muhammad Abu Fani, will not be in the squad for the Haifa derby against Hapoel Haifa that will be held tonight (Wednesday) in the round of 16 of the State Cup.
The midfielder is suffering from pain in his ribs and yesterday he abandoned the final training session.
In light of the fact that there is no benefit in his situation, it was decided not to include him in the roster.
Because of this, midfielder Neta Lavi may start in Barak Bakr's 11 next to Ali Muhammad, despite the fact that in the background there are negotiations going on about his transfer to the Japanese Gamba Osaka.
Beyond that, coach Barak Becher may make another change or two in the 11, when there is a debate between Raz Meir and Linon Eliyahu in the right back position.
On the other hand, Hapoel Haifa will arrive with a missing lineup.
The brakes Hatem Abdelhamid (injured) and Constantinos Sotrio (suspended) will be missed.
Louis Taha will start in the 11th despite suffering from fluid in his knee.
Niso Capiluto will also play as he only recently returned from injury.
Midfielder Liran Sardel is injured but will get a shot and will be in the squad.
Coach Roni Levy is expected to return striker Alon Turgeman to the 11, after he was eliminated on Saturday against Bnei Sakhnin.
Kwami Kawi will return to the bench.
